New York Mets (Colon) at Los Angeles Angels (Wilson)

Bartolo “Sideshow” Colon will be hurling for the Mets today and he’s pitched fairly well so far this year. His price presents a reasonable risk, though, and without the strikeouts I don’t know if I can be very high on him. The Mets have put some runs on the board this weekend but I wonder if it’s their hitting or a lack of good pitchers they’ve faced.

Juan Lagares (OF) – $4386

Mike Trout’s price is a bit ridiculous but this is one of the few days where it might pay off: His career against Colon is 7-for-14 with two home runs out of those seven hits. If DFSers can figure out a way to get him in the lineup, it’s one of the few days I’d recommend it. I also like the Str8 Edge Racer on the mound for this one.
